TE TŪRANGA I THE ROLE

Ever wanted the best seat in the house without leaving the control room? As an MCR (Master Control Room) Operator at Sky, you’ll be at the heart of the action – watching content seconds before it hits screens across the country. 

You’ll play a key role in delivering broadcast content to our customers around the clock, making sure our systems run smoothly and live moments land on air without a glitch. Whether it’s troubleshooting a feed from Eden Park, managing international broadcast links, or coordinating with global service providers – you’ll be in the thick of it, making magic happen behind the scenes. 

This is a hands-on technical role within a 24/7 broadcast environment. You’ll work 12-hour shifts across a rotating roster including days, overnights, and weekends. If you thrive under pressure, love live content, and enjoy solving problems on the fly, this could be your calling. 

Key responsibilities will include: 

  • Monitor and manage the quality and continuity of broadcast content across satellite, fibre, and IP networks 
  • Operate Sky’s contribution and distribution systems from source to screen 
  • Identify, troubleshoot, and resolve service issues – before they impact customers 
  • Work closely with broadcasters, service providers and internal teams to ensure seamless delivery 
  • Keep detailed operational records and support continuous improvement through incident management and root-cause analysis 
  • Ensure services meet broadcast standards and SLAs 
  • Bring a proactive, solutions-focused mindset to every shift 

NGĀ PŪKENGA ME NGĀ WHEAKO I WHAT YOU WILL BRING: 

ESSENTIAL: 

  • Completed a recognised Broadcast or Media course (with practical and theoretical training), or equivalent experience 
  • Hands-on experience solving complex systems problems in a broadcast or technical environment 
  • Understanding of Broadcast Standards Authority (BSA) regulations 

PREFERRED: 

  • 1–2 years' experience in a multi-disciplined MCR or similar technical operations role 
  • Knowledge of signal contribution/distribution across satellite, fibre, and IP 
  • Relevant technical qualification such as Engineering, NZCE (Telecommunications), or a Certificate in Applied Technology (Electronics)
